Output 0576e0621da62153d011450589619303e8e39f53ef35d4f19fdba3900bbc751f:0

value
996464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83b935ff8e5b485cb639e6c69bf08d29294331d OP_EQUAL
address
3KwkSJQPZ6vTXZNhremhnEyeshufSfsSRN
transaction
0576e0621da62153d011450589619303e8e39f53ef35d4f19fdba3900bbc751f
spent
true